Taxonomic Classification

Rank Buffy-headed Marmoset Volcano Wart Lichen
Kingdom Animalia (Animals) Fungi (Fungi)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Ascomycota (Sac Fungi)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Lecanoromycetes (Lecanoromycetes)
Order Primates (Primates) Pertusariales (Pertusariales)
Family Callitrichidae Pertusariaceae
Genus Callithrix Pertusaria
Species Callithrix flaviceps Pertusaria xanthodes
